After dropping idea about buying Skoda Laura I started my research yet again. My top priority was to get diesel automatic. So I decided that I will buy Maruti Ritz Vdi which was readily available in stock and get it fitted with City Clutch. After some research and googling I found a local dealer who is dealing with city clutch and arranged for demo.

Woke up next morning and confirmed that I could visit him and scooted away to his place. I met Mr. Srinivas Prasad a humble man. He is physically handicapped with his right leg affected by polio. We started conversation about the City Clutch and the history of the device and his friend Mr. Patel from Gujarat whom he had close ties etc. Finally we went for demo with his Hyundai Verna which was fitted with City Clutch.

Before demo I thought I maybe wasting time. But after I took his verna for drive, it changed all. He was very polite and answered all my queries.

The device is 3 part. The micro processor controller, gear knob with switch and the motor. The functionality is very simple. The MPC monitors the car RPM and based on input it adjusts the clutch. To change gear I need to press the button on the knob and the clutch gets depressed while I change gear. After gear is changed the accelarator needs to be paddled for the movement. When the car is in idle the clutch remains depressed and once gear is in position with throttling clutch gets released with movement of car. He also explained how I could adjust the micro processor to suit my driving style. It was a wonderful drive.

By end of the drive I was convinced with the device. I will be getting this installed on my next car for sure. I will keep you guys posted how well it will serve me.

Automatic clutch system

A friend was having disability in using the clutch (left leg operation).
So i searched in net for procedure for making an existing car in to automatic.
Came up on something called Automatic clutch system .
This is not what Maruti Suzuki is promised for the upcoming hatchback.
Means not AMT.
The entire transmission system will be as it is .Even the clutch pedal will remain.
The clutch is controlled by an actuator which is controlled by a button on the gear shift liver .We can switch on and off this system .If one wants to use the clutch pedal,just switch it off.
More info in the link below.
Called up the numbers and got a quote for Rs 48 K.
The vehicle needs to be sent to Chennai.

Automatic Clutch System for Car
With Automatic Clutch System For Car you can convert a manual car to semi-automatic at the touch of a button. We manufacture and supply all types of cars and light duty vans matching to hectic traffic conditions. This is an intelligent electronically controlled mechanism which enables the driver to select gears simply by pressing a button on the gear lever and shifting. This automatically activates the clutch pedal movement in a completely controlled system. The car can be driven by using just the brake and accelerator. In traffic when releasing the brake pedal the car creeps forward like an automatic. Auto Clutch takes the fatigue away from having to operate the clutch pedal continuously, particularly in traffic situations.

Auto clutch is mainly comprised of two units. The first elaborate electronic control unit controls the second compact electric motor. The electric motor is mechanically connected to the clutch pedal with a cable. The accelerator pedal, brake pedal, hand brake and road speed are monitored for signals which result in automatic activation of the system. The entire system is installed in the interior compartment of the car. Some of the features are:
Change gear without using your foot to operate the clutch
Easy to operate
No engine or gearbox modifications
Can be switched on or off even while driving
Economic time spending to install
More fuel economical than an automatic
Creeps like an automatic
Transferable to your next car.
